Responsibilities

  • Develop and implement a global warehousing and transportation strategy aligned with business objectives
  • Establish standard operating procedures (SOPs), key performance indicators (KPIs), benchmarks, and best practices for warehousing, transportation, and distribution operations ensuring operational efficiency, accuracy, and on-time delivery
  • Drive network optimization initiatives to improve cost efficiency, service levels, and sustainability
  • Oversee the operation and performance of multi segment distribution centers, ensuring operational efficiency, accuracy, and on-time delivery
  • Monitor global transportation trends and regulations to ensure compliance and risk mitigation
  • Ensure compliance with international trade laws, customs regulations, and environmental policies
  • Manage and own operational relationships with third-party logistics providers (3PLs), freight carriers, and warehouse partners
  • Work cross-functionally with procurement, planning, operations, and finance teams to align logistics strategies with business goals
  • Evaluate and implement advanced logistics technologies such as Warehouse Management Systems (WMS) and Transportation Management Systems (TMS), and Internet of Things (IoT) solutions
  • Develop risk management frameworks for warehousing and transportation disruptions

About Xylem

Xylem focuses on developing solutions to tackle global water challenges through smart technology. The company provides a range of products and services aimed at ensuring water security and sustainability. Its offerings include advanced water pumps, treatment systems, and analytical instruments, as well as hydrographic software through its HYPACK brand, which is used by clients worldwide for managing water bodies. Xylem serves various clients, including municipalities, industrial companies, and agricultural businesses, helping them manage water resources efficiently and improve water quality. Unlike many competitors, Xylem combines both hardware and software solutions, allowing for a comprehensive approach to water management. The company's goal is to promote sustainability and address environmental concerns while meeting the increasing demand for eco-friendly water solutions.
